WICHITA, Kan. – Thursday evening marked the end of the multis portion of the Coach Wilson Invitational, hosted by Wichita State. Tabor's
Caleb Wehrman completed his first heptathlon of the 2025-26 season, breaking the previous school record he set a season ago.
His performance was highlighted by event titles in the pole vault and shot put, while setting lifetime best marks in the high jump and hurdles and setting season-best marks in the long jump, 60m, and pole vault.
